Tool-Mover able to handle large molds

Published: December 5, 2012 6:00 am ET

RUD Chains Ltd. has developed the Innovative Tool-Mover, a device for the safe turning and tilting of heavy and awkward items, such as large injection molds.

It turns the load at the center of gravity, which means the load is turned very smoothly and securely. A frequency controlled drive ensures an even and smooth drive. The device can be stopped securely, in any position, even if power to the unit is cut off.

The Tool-Mover does not need to be bolted to the floor, so it can be moved to new locations using a crane or a fork lift.

Polyurethane plates cover the unit, helping to keep tools from getting damaged.

RUD Chains is based in Kent, England.
